I wanted to transfer all my Furl bookmarks to Diigo but there was one major problem: At Furl, there are topics, which are kind of like folders and there are keywords, which are the actual equivalent to tags. When I imported my Furl bookmarks into Diigo, only the topics were imported as tags and no keywords at all.
Is there any way how I can import my Furl bookmarks into Diigo with the keywords becoming the tags?
I found another post here dealing with that same problem and a tip by Daniel Gauthier. He suggests a workaround solution by using Blinklist as an intermediary service to which Furl bookmarks can be imported with all tags and from which the bookmarks can then be imported into Diigo. I tried this and it failed (Importing failed - Please make sure that bookmarks file is correct and contains your bookmarks.) It definitely is the correct XML file, so I don't know what the problem is.
Any other solutions to get my Furl bookmarks into Diigo with all the tags?
